The healing process for jaw implants can vary depending on the individual, the complexity of the procedure, and the surgeon's expertise. However, on average, you can expect a healing time of around 4-6 weeks.
The initial recovery period after the surgery is typically the most challenging. During the first week, you may experience swelling, bruising, and some discomfort in the jaw area. It's important to follow the surgeon's instructions closely, including taking pain medication as prescribed and applying cold compresses to the affected area. Patients are usually advised to stick to a liquid or soft diet during this time to avoid putting too much pressure on the newly placed implants.
Around the second week, the swelling and discomfort should start to subside, and you may be able to gradually introduce solid foods back into your diet. However, it's crucial to avoid hard, chewy, or crunchy foods that could potentially dislodge the implants. At this stage, you may also be able to return to light activities, such as walking, but strenuous exercise should still be avoided.
By the fourth week, the majority of the visible signs of the surgery should have healed, and you may be able to resume more normal daily activities. The jaw implants will still be in the process of integrating with the surrounding bone, so it's essential to continue to be cautious with your diet and physical activity. Your surgeon will likely recommend regular follow-up appointments to monitor the healing process and ensure the implants are properly settling.
It's important to note that the healing time can vary from person to person, and some individuals may take a little longer to fully recover. Factors such as age, overall health, and any underlying medical conditions can all play a role in the healing process. Additionally, the specific type of jaw implant used and the complexity of the procedure can also affect the recovery timeline.
Throughout the healing process, it's crucial to follow your surgeon's instructions closely and maintain good oral hygiene. This will help minimize the risk of complications, such as infection, and ensure the best possible outcome for your jaw implant procedure.
